Historically, wealth is definitely kept in the funding values of assets like land, property and gold. Those were the assets on what kings built kingdoms, in addition to being essential, non-perishable assets, ownership of huge levels of all of these things ended in wealth and power. It is just because the recent (in historical terms) introduction of fiat currencies and markets that investors attempt to build up piles of 'currency' instead.


Spurred by the recent global financial meltdown, most, totally investors, hold less faith than any other time in entrusting their future to financial markets, with lots of having recently witnessed savings and pension values collapse since the markets again crashed. Now, investors are searhing for alternatives investments, again turning their focus to real, tangible assets with an essential function which are in low supply and demand. Institutional investors are getting farmland, like a growing global population will usually need feeding, along with what little arable land there exists will end up ever-more valuable after a while, in tangible terms and financial terms. Other medication is buying commercial timber properties as a way to grow hardwoods to meet new demand from growing populations in China, India and South america, because these emerging markets forge ahead with resource intensive development. Some investors are turning their backs on savings accounts and instead buying physical gold each month or year, building a portfolio from the yellow metal that can likely generate a far superior cash value to traditional savings tools after ten years. There is in reality a whole field of investment options to pick from,; including fine wine, sustainable energy assets, and rare stamps and coins, that surge in value for their rarity increases and demand from new buyers emerging from 'new wealth' economies increases. Trust deed investing assets all behave very differently, along with their values or income potential affect ted by variable unique to the sector or specific property or asset. Most alternatives however share a standard characteristic, and that's illiquidity. As mostly tangible and property-based assets, alternatives to traded financial instruments might be difficult to sell quickly or in any respect in certain markets, and investors must make themselves aware of the asset specific risks related to anything they decide to spend money on. Investors seeking income will quickly realize some investment options to be more suitable than the others, and the same could be said for all those investors seeking stable, long-term capital growth.
